<title>net: dsa: b53: Ensure the default VID is untagged</title>

We need to ensure that the default VID is untagged otherwise the switch
will be sending tagged frames and the results can be problematic. This
is especially true with b53 switches that use VID 0 as their default
VLAN since VID 0 has a special meaning.

<title>net: dsa: bcm_sf2: Forcibly configure IMP port for 1Gb/sec</title>

We are still experiencing some packet loss with the existing advanced
congestion buffering (ACB) settings with the IMP port configured for
2Gb/sec, so revert to conservative link speeds that do not produce
packet loss until this is resolved.

<title>net: dsa: b53: Fix default VLAN ID</title>

We were not consistent in how the default VID of a given port was
defined, b53_br_leave() would make sure the VLAN ID would be either 0/1
depending on the switch generation, but b53_configure_vlan(), which is
the default configuration would unconditionally set it to 1. The correct
value is 1 for 5325/5365 series and 0 otherwise. To avoid repeating that
mistake ever again, introduce a helper function: b53_default_pvid() to
factor that out.

<title>net: dsa: mv88e6xxx: Preserve priority when setting CPU port.</title>

The 6390 family uses an extended register to set the port connected to
the CPU. The lower 5 bits indicate the port, the upper three bits are
the priority of the frames as they pass through the switch, what
egress queue they should use, etc. Since frames being set to the CPU
are typically management frames, BPDU, IGMP, ARP, etc set the priority
to 7, the reset default, and the highest.
